@Skofild2016
Изучаю Frontend

Как вытащить читабельный пароль из Битрикс?

Добрый день, подскажите как можно достать пароль из битрикса в читабельном виде а не в виде хеша.
Требуется отправить повторное письмо о регистрации с логином и паролем (отправку делаю через cevent::send, сейчас пароль приходиться вносить вручную), поля с логином и именем достаю через CUser, пароль только как хеш. Можно как то привести пароль в человеко понятный?
  • Вопрос задан
  • 794 просмотра
Пригласить эксперта
Ответы на вопрос 1
Понимаю, что поздно, но вдруг кто-то интересуется. Это не совсем ответ на вопрос, а скорее мысли, как решить проблему с утерянным доступом пользователя к сайту.

У Битрикса пароли хешируются по алгоритму SHA-512, поэтому получить из этого читабельный пароль - это впустую потраченное время. Вместо этого предлагаю несколько вариантов:
  1. Самым правильным способом считаю отправку на почту ссылки на восстановление пароля, человек переходит и просто его меняет
  2. Как вариант, ещё можно сгенерировать новый пароль самому и отправить пароль и логин на почту, в этом случае пользователю останется только ввести авторизационные данные и не париться с формой восстановления пароля.
  3. И самый плохой вариант, это сохранять пароли в каком-нибудь пользовательском поле и по его запросу, отправлять ему тот пароль, который он задал
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ы